No one at a local station or at home even noticed if the network were sending color unless you had a color monitor, or noticed the color burst on a scope. The color H &V rate changes had no effect since by intent they were so close to mono standards.
That's not true. On a good B&W set the difference is very obvious due to dot crawl on a color picture.

The difference is vertical rate is also obvious if the set has any hum in either
vertical sync or video.
